
Art in Small Scale Societies by Richard L Anderson
This volume gives important insights into art as an aesthetically powerful artifact that plays a vital role in the social, intellectual and affective lives of the people who make and use it. Based on field studies of hunter-gatherer, horticultural and pastoral peoples, it provides an account of questions regarding art in its cultural context.
